What will be the vapour pressure of a solution containing 5 moles of sucrose `(C_(12)H_(22)O_(11))` in 1 kg of water, if the vapour pressure of pure water is `4*57` mm of Hg ? `[C = 12, H=1,0 = 16]`

Text Solution

AI Generated Solution

To find the vapor pressure of the solution containing 5 moles of sucrose in 1 kg of water, we can use Raoult's Law, which states that the vapor pressure of a solution is equal to the vapor pressure of the pure solvent multiplied by the mole fraction of the solvent in the solution. ### Step-by-Step Solution: 1. **Determine the vapor pressure of pure water**: - Given: Vapor pressure of pure water = 4.57 mm of Hg. 2. **Calculate the number of moles of water**: ...
